Disbelief at £250,000 win for Huntingdon man

A man from Huntingdon is celebrating after he revealed a £250,000 top prize on a Super 7s Scratchcard from National Lottery GameStore.

Jeremiah Johnson popped into his local supermarket on the way home from work when he bought the winning Scratchcard. Once home, and with his wife Joy making supper, the father of 2 sat down in front of the TV and decided to play.

"I wasn't really paying attention to the TV or the game until I saw that I had revealed four matching symbols and the caption below was £250,000. I couldn't believe what I was seeing, uttered a couple of choice words and then triple and quadruple checked it again."

Not daring to believe he really had won £250,000 Jeremiah ran into the kitchen asking Joy to check the Scratchcard for him.

He said, "I enjoy playing the odd National Lottery Scratchcard and have had some nice wins along the way but nothing of this size. I genuinely never played believing I would have a big win so when that £250,000 winning symbol was glaring back at me I just couldn't fathom it. I asked Joy to look but she said she had no idea how to play!"

Jeremiah then ran back to the shop so they could check if there was a win on the Super 7s Scratchcard. When he was told he had to contact Camelot directly, Jeremiah started to believe it really was a big win and quickly called them to confirm.

Future plans

With Jeremiah's £250,000 win safely in his bank account the US government employee, originally from North Carolina, can start to make plans for the future.

"We will use some of the win to clear some loans, a large portion will be put into a college fund for our 2 children, another portion for a few more bits of furniture and the rest will be a nice little nest egg for the future."

Jeremiah has been based at RAF Molesworth for the last 3 years but will be moving to Germany at the end of the summer. He said, "We are really sad to leave the UK, we love it here and will take with us some amazing memories, not least this win – the perfect souvenir of our time here!"
